基于RFID技术的婴儿监护系统的设计
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
2012年第2期福建电脑
基于RFID技术的婴儿监护系统的设计
王丽琴,徐炜
(温州医学院信息与工程学院浙江温州325035)
【摘要】:RFID以无线射频方式实现多目标、运动目标的识别,在各领域各行业显示了巨大的应用前景。本文介绍一种利用RFID技术设计的婴儿监护系统,该系统根据结合了有源RFID设计的智能防盗标签和部署的专用网络,运用数据库技术和数据分析技术,确定婴儿位置,确保母婴配对,自动记录婴儿护理状况,并联动了门闸报警机制。
【关键词】:RFID;婴儿监护;防盗标签;护理操作;无线网络;
0、引言
医院每天都有许多新生婴儿出生,由于新生婴儿抵抗力差,容易感染疾病,甚至有的一出生就带有先天性的疾病,同时因为新生婴儿外貌特征相似而且几乎没有自我表达和与人沟通的能力,若不加以有效监控往往会造成医疗差错[1],但是随着无线网络技术和射频识别技术(RFID)的发展,将两者结合起来能够有效地预防和避免医疗差错的发生[2],维护医患双方的利益。
本文基于RFID技术设计的婴儿监护系统,通过婴儿佩戴RFID标签,护士可以通过PDA掌上计算机直接采集和录入婴儿信息,如:医嘱由谁执行,医嘱何时执行,婴儿生理指标,护理情况(服药、体温测量次数、尿布更换次数、喂奶次数)等[2]。
婴儿监护系统主要包括婴儿防盗系统和婴儿护理监测系统两大部分。
由于近年来婴儿失窃、婴儿抱错事件在一些医院时有发生,此类事件给医院、被盗婴儿家庭各方面都带来了灾难性的后果。针对此类问题,在研究RFID(射频识别)应用技术,特别是信号读卡器和信号接收器的工作原理及其设备;开发能满足医院里防止婴儿抱错和偷盗行为的防盗系统。研究开发当电子标签被恶意拆除时能启动警报系统的实现方法和装置,确保婴儿安全,保障各方利益。
1、RFID技术简介
RFID(Radio Frequency Identification)即射频识别,是一种非接触式的自动识别技术,它通过无线射频方式进行非接触双向数据通信,对目标对象加以识别并获取相关数据,识别工作无须人工干预,可工作于各种恶劣环境。RFID技术可识别高速运动物体并可同时识别多个标签,操作快捷方便[3]。
RFID技术的基本原理是利用无线射频信号的空间耦合实现对被识别物体的自动识别。RFID系统的基本工作方式是将RFID标签安装在被识别物体上(粘贴、嵌入、佩挂或植入等),当被识别物体进入RFID读写器的读写范围内(射频场)时,标签与读写器之间建立起联系,其过程一般由读写器启动,然后标签向读写器发送自身信息,例如标签编号和标签内存储的数据等,读写器接收信息并解码后,传送给计算机进行处理[4]。
RFID读写器能同时扫描多个标签,且RFID识读器具有较大的存储容量,能存储几千个字符数据;另外RFID标签可以用酒精擦拭,有效地避免了在潮湿环境下使用或是受到血液污染、磨损等情况[5]。
2、系统总体设计
2.1系统功能
为了实现婴儿监护系统功能,我们在医院及病区建立无线网络,部署无线AP(Access Point),给每个婴儿和产妇都佩戴RFID标签[6]。护士携带便携式RFID 读写器直接读取患者所佩带的RFID信息并显示婴儿和产妇的信息,这样可以使医护人员对患者身份进行快速准确的识别,确保医疗操作对象和母婴配对的关系正确,同时将相关操作的数据信息通过便携式RFID 读写器录入到HIS系统中。在病区安装的中远距离RFID阅读器,可以实时读取到婴儿所在区域和移动方向,婴儿出入病区时,根据其授权状态自动地记录到HIS系统,如果没有获取出入授权,不会打开门闸并立即进行实时报警[7]。
基金项目:2011年温州医学院学生科研立项资助项目,NO.wyx201101062图表1
系统的物理结构
33
福建电脑2012年第2期
本系统运行在Windows XP 环境下,通过RS-485网络读取RFID 阅读器扫描到的标签信息,根据阅读器及天线的布局位置图、标签出现的时间及先后关系,确定婴儿的位置及状态。护理信息通过SQL Server ODBC 驱动程序连接HIS 数据库,实现数据交互。本系统的物理结构如图表1所示:
婴儿监护系统软件由患者管理、医嘱处理、药品管理、医护人员权限、数据查询和统计模块组成。基于RFID 的婴儿监护系统的总体结构如图表2所示:
婴儿监护系统具有以下功能:
(1)强制或者恶意拆除RFID 标签时,会引发警报系统,确保患者的安全;
(2)通过扫描RFID 标签能唯一确定患者以及医护人员的身份信息,录入患者信息;
(3)实时录入患者护理操作及数据信息(如体温、喂奶次数、喂药情况等);
(4)护理操作遗漏提醒功能:接近设定护理操作的预设时间时制定提醒功能,提醒医护人员所应进行的护理操作;
(5)能够完成医嘱单的入录、核对、执行等操作,并记录患者的用药反应情况;
(6)患者的离开都应先获取权限,只有取得“外出”权限才能自由出入,否则将会启动警报机制,提高系统安全性;
(7)数据查询、统计功能方便医护人员及时了解患者的信息以及生长情况;提供报表统计、打印功能;
(8)提供数据备份、还原功能,确保数据安全性。2.2系统实现
目前,各个医院基本上都已建立了HIS 系统,并布置了遍及医院的网络,本文设计婴儿监护系统利用了医院现有的HIS 系统和网络,并在此基础上完成对患者、医疗设备及药品的管理,系统由硬件及软件两部分组成[8]。
2.2.1硬件系统设计
本婴儿监护系统的硬件系统主要由防盗RFID 标签、RFID 天线及阅读器、RFID 系统服务器、警报控制
器、终端计算机和网络设备组成,系统的各个组成部分通过网络构成一个整体。
其中最关键的是RFID 防盗标签的设计,该标签是采用微控制器、有源RFID 、电池以及IR 温度传感器、加速度传感器组成的一个智能设备。微控制器通过IR 温度传感器不但可以随时监测婴儿体温,同时可以判断是否标签还在婴儿手臂上,另外,微控制器还通过加速度传感器判断是婴儿动作还是成人帮助婴儿的动作及拆除标签的动作,从而,防止标签被恶意摘除。通过微控制器控制有源RFID 接通电源的时间间隔,来传递该防盗标签的状态信息。该标签采用全封闭结构,需要通过特殊的红外遥控器才能启动该标签的工作或使该标签停止工作。
2.2.2软件系统设计
基于RFID 的婴儿监护系统软件实现包括数据库和应用软件实现,其中数据库是利用Sybase PowerDe -signer 设计开发,包括患者信息表、医嘱表、护理操作数据表等。其中RFID 标签与数据库中患者住院ID 号唯一对应。
应用软件采用 Framework 4,开发语言为C#,开发环境为Microsoft Visual Studio 2010。应用软件的流程如图表3所示:
流程图中,首先是医护人员进行系统登陆和功能权限选择,分别对护理监护系统和婴儿防盗系统进行操作。
护理流程:医护人员扫描RFID 标签,对患者身份进行唯一确认,确认后完成医嘱核对以及相应的护理操作,并把护理操作数据提交到HIS 进行存储、处理。其中医护人员若要进行数据修改、统计时,只有获得权限的人员才能进行操作,否则无权操作,进一步保证了数据的真实性。
警报流程:医护人员先要获取病人“外出”的权限,病人才能安全离开,否则会启动警报机制,系统并对病人外出期间进行实时监控,是医护人员及时掌握病人的动态;当病人回来时撤销病人“外出”(下转第25页)
图表2
系统的逻辑结构
图表3基于RFID
的婴儿监护系统的流程图
34